Here is a superb pair of matt and shiny gilt bronze candlesticks / candlesticks from the Empire period, made up of different elements with very fine carving.
An identical pair is kept at the Chuvalov Palace in Saint Petersburg where the 1831 inventory of the latter notes: "pair of torches, torso frieze barrel with griffins, lyres, foliage and palmettes on a round base with rosette of palmettes". Bequest of General Pavel Andreïevich Chouvalov (1776-1823, general of the Russian imperial army during the Napoleonic wars), origin: France 1808, Galle rue Vivienne n ° 9 in Paris.

Like Pierre Philippe Thomire, Claude Galle recorded numerous orders for the Russian market and its high dignitaries. He perfectly understood the Soviets' taste for carvings and details in abundance and produced models for their attention.
The design and precision of the carving of this model are the best proof of this.
Take for example the griffins, they are no more than 8mm each and yet are of surgical precision.
This rare model of torches / candlesticks still has its beautiful original gilding.
